Los Angeles Chargers owner Dean Spanos has been accused of "misogynistic" behavior, "self-dealing" and repeated "breaches of fiduciary duty" by his sister in a lawsuit that escalates the siblings' ongoing legal battle over control of the team. One example, taken from the lawsuit: Dean continues to use Trust assets as collateral, draw on the Trusts lines of, credit, and refuses to pay dividends for his own personal benefit and in breach of his fiduciary duties. The legal conflict came into public view in April 2021, when Berberian petitioned the Los Angeles County Superior Court to put the trust up for sale. For example, despite the fact that TSC (The Spanos Corporation) conducted little to no business in Las Vegas for decades, Dean insisted on keeping a TSC office there so that he could write-off private flights to enjoy his second home and get his hair cut, since Las Vegas is where Deans barber is based., The suit alleges, while Dean and Dea are the co-trustees, Michael has been misrepresenting himself as a trustee and the brothers have attempted to freeze their sister out of the trusts decision-making process because Dean and Michael believe to their cores that, regardless of what their parents intended and their wills specified, men are in charge and women should shut up.. Berberian claims that Dean's decision to relocate the Chargers from San Diego back to Los Angeles in 2017 has put the trust more than $358 million in debt. Dea Spanos Berberian filed the suit Thursday in San Joaquin County Superior Court, as ESPN reported, seeking sole control of the Spanos Family Trust that constitutes more than one-third of the Chargers' ownership. Berberian has sought to have the 36 percent stake of the team controlled by the Spanos trust sold as she claims the team is unable to fulfill its financial commitments to charitable causes due to the debt of the franchise. The lawsuit is also seeking financial damages from Berberians other brother, Michael Spanos, and Steven Cohen, the executive vice president and COO of The Spanos Corporation (TSC). The petition asks the court to order Berberian and Spanos to take steps to sell the trusts share of the Chargers and invoke a provision of trust law that would require the teams other shareholders to do the same. In an attempt to force the sale of the Chargers, a sister of controlling owner Dean Spanos filed a petition in Los Angeles County Superior Court on Thursday arguing that mounting debt has imperiled the familys finances and the only solution is to put the NFL franchise on the market. Rather than seeking to monetize illiquid assets in order to pay debts and liabilities, and make distributions to beneficiaries, the Co-Trustees have principally been borrowing, including borrowing money from one bank to pay another, the petition said. Alex Spanos, a billionaire real estate developer, took ownership of the then-San Diego franchise in 1984, buying 60% of the team for $48.3 million. Streisand previously represented Steve Ballmer in his purchase of the Clippers and Jeanie Buss in the legal fight that cemented her as controlling owner of the Lakers. Berberian also accuses her brothers of conspiring with Steven Cohen, the executive vice president and COO of The Spanos Corporation, to undermine Berberian by "deliberately" damaging her relationship with the pastor of her Greek Orthodox church, Father Alex Karloutsos.
